TUTTI, Cosey Fanni. Art Sex Music. London: Faber & Faber. 2017.
8vo. Publisher’s white boards, photograph of author pasted to front, in original white slipcase, photographic endpapers, loosely inserted photograph signed by Fanni Tutti in a red envelope; pp. ix, [1 (blank)], 502, with two unpaginated suites (each 4 pp.) of colour and black-and-white photographs; a little shelf wear and rubbing to white slipcase; near fine.
Limited edition of Cosey Fanni Tutti’s autobiography recounting her extraordinary life in music, performance, and counterculture, number 66 of 205 copies, signed by the author and with a signed photograph.
Cosey Fanni Tutti (born Christine Carol Newby in 1951, her name change inspired by Mozart’s Così fan tutte) is perhaps best known as a founding member of the avant-garde rock group Throbbing Gristle, and for her work with the performance art collective COUM Transmissions, where she transformed her experiences in pornography into radical art and installations.
